I'm trying to filter certain devices from displaying the USB Connection dialogue, and according to my understanding, this can be done by creating a device filter, specifiying the devices to allow, then processing the intent within my activity.
The issue that I'm having is that it prompts regardless of what device I connect (It does not restrict to the list within device_filter.xml).
How can I limit the connection prompts to the devices listed in device_filter.xml?
device_filter.xml :
<?xml version="1.0" encoding="utf-8"?> <resources> <usb-device vendor-id="1027" product-id="24597"> <usb-device vendor-id="1659" product-id="8963" > </resources>
This file contains the devices I wish to whitelist.
from AndroidManifest.xml :
<activity
android:name=".Player"
android:clearTaskOnLaunch="true"
android:configChanges="orientation|keyboardHidden"
android:exported="true"
android:label="@string/app_name" >
<intent-filter>
<action android:name="android.intent.action.MAIN" />
<category android:name="android.intent.category.LAUNCHER" />
</intent-filter>
<intent-filter>
<action android:name="android.hardware.usb.action.USB_DEVICE_ATTACHED" />
</intent-filter>
<meta-data
android:name="android.hardware.usb.action.USB_DEVICE_ATTACHED"
android:resource="@xml/device_filter" />
</activity>

A little bit late, but your filter is not well formed:
<usb-device vendor-id="1027" product-id="24597" />
You're missing a slash (/) to close the tag.
